automatic

(noun, adjective)

adjective

1. operating with minimal human intervention; independent of external control

- automatic transmission

- a budget deficit that caused automatic spending cuts

Similar word(s): autoloading, semiautomatic, automated, smart, mechanical

2. resembling the unthinking functioning of a machine

- an automatic `thank you'

Similar word(s): mechanical, automatonlike, machinelike, robotic, robotlike

3. without volition or conscious control

- the automatic shrinking of the pupils of the eye in strong light

Similar word(s): involuntary, reflex, reflexive
